Publisher's Synopsis

With public demand for community schools on the rise, this timely book provides an empowering, step-by-step approach for school leaders to cultivate community school practices within their schools while simultaneously engaging in the policy advocacy process. This is an actionable toolkit with practical advice, helpful checklists and inventories, as well as real examples from rural and urban schools. Drawing from the experiences of real school leaders involved in community school initiatives, this book illuminates the promise of community schools as centers of the community and sites accessible beyond regular school hours. Community schools bring together educators, local community members, families, and students to provide partnerships that strengthen conditions for student learning and healthy development. Making Community Schools a Reality is a timely and comprehensive resource that helps educational leaders improve learning outcomes and promote equity in their schools.
